   | At 
              a recent meeting of the Fairmile Natter near Cobham in Surrey (the 
              former Talbot Natter at Ripley), Ian Ailes (Glacier White 
              1561) from Surrey referred to the recent V8NOTE374 
              from Bill McCullough on V8 cooling and then produced an astonishing 
              photograph. He explained that when he was refurbishing his V8 and 
              had the manifold off, he discovered a blockage in one of the cooling 
              water passageways. The obstruction (see left) looks like a half 
              pence coin. Quite extraordinary!
 Ian comments the "car seems to be running cooler - but I 
              have fitted an uprated radiator!"
  Ian wondered if 
              any other member had seen a similar object in the water passageway 
              of their manifold on an MGBGTV8? (2.4.08) |
